I have Logitech G402 mouse. I bought it like 3 months ago.
Today, in the morning, I was playing Witcher 3. And it suddenly stopped working. I unplugged and plugged it again. And it said "USB Device not recognized. The last USB device connected to the computer has malfunctioned and Windows cannot recognize it."
The thing is, I know that the above message usually means that the mouse is probably dead now and its useless to have any hopes at all. I have used 100s of cheap 5$ mice before and I am now used to this.
But the thing is, its different this time. Usually, the mice start to die gradually. Like, the first time, the mouse doesn't work and when you plug it again, it works fine. And after a week or so, you have to re plug it several times, adjust its wire and then it works fine. However, my G402 stopped working suddenly. I have never had any issues before this. This is the first time. And adjusting the wire doesn't help at all. I restarted the PC, didnt help. I connected the mouse to a smart TV, didnt help. I connected the mouse to my smartphone via an OTG, didnt help.
I have neither treated the mouse roughly nor have I ever dropped it on the floor.
One thing I have noticed is that, the LED at the bottom of the mouse lights up as it should when I connect it. The LED is dim. I have to peek into it to see the red dim light. Thats how its supposed to be, though. It was the same when I bought it too. So I guess thats working fine? But the Logitech logo on the mouse doesnt work and of course, it doesnt work. No clicks, no movement.
